226 Chifley to MacArthur

Message CAB302 CANBERRA, 31 August 1945

IMMEDIATE TOP SECRET

I thank you for your message CX.10599 of 28th August [1],
embodying copy of General Headquarters General Orders No. 41, from
which it is noted that, as from 1200 hours, 2nd September, 1945,
the Southwest Pacific Command will be dissolved, and the portion
of the Southwest Pacific Area defined in the Order will be
transferred to British and Australian Command.

2. The Government has approved that the control of the combat
sections of the Australian Defence Forces, which was assigned to
you as Commander-in-Chief, Southwest Pacific Area, on 18th April,
1942, shall revert, as from 2nd September, to the authorities in
whom it was vested before that date, namely:-

Royal Australian Navy - Naval Board.

Australian Military Forces - Commander-in-Chief,
Australian Military Forces.

Royal Australian Air Force - Air Board.

3. It is noted from paragraph 1 (a) of General Orders No. 41 that
Admiralty Islands, which are part of the Australian Mandate,
remain outside the area to be transferred to British Commonwealth
Control and will be under United States control. You will be aware
from my letters of 14th June [2] and 27th July [3], communicating
the Government's views on the Australian war effort and the future
set-up in the Southwest Pacific Area, that it is the desire of the
Government that control of Australian Mandated Territories should
revert to it upon the dissolution of the Southwest Pacific [Area].

The Commonwealth Government assumes that this arrangement is for
purely military purposes, will be strictly limited in duration,
and is without prejudice to our ultimate arrangements for the
establishment of civil control. [4]

1 On file AA : A6494 T1, SPTS/1/3.

2 In AA : A5954, box 2313. This letter confirmed cablegrams
exchanged between Chifley and MacArthur on 18 and 20 May
(published as Documents 88, 89 and 90), and drew attention to
matters covered in Document 97.

3 In the file cited in note 2. It included a paraphrase of
Document 138.

4 MacArthur replied in Message BXC131, dispatched 6 September,
that the Australian Govt's position regarding Mandated Territories
had been transmitted to Washington where, it was assumed, it would
be handled on the highest level. In AA : A5954, box 569.
